Animal and Public Health Symposium Seeks Presenters

Have you worked on a project or developed resources related to animal or public health this year? Would you like to share it with an avid audience? Presenters wanted for the 7th Annual Applied Animal and Public Health Research and Extension Symposium. This event is sponsored by the American Association of Extension Veterinarians and will be held on Saturday, October 1, 2011 from 3:00 - 6:00pm in Buffalo, NY (coincides with the US Animal Health Association Annual Meeting).

Presenters will be given 15 minutes to summarize a project that highlights animal or public health topic applicable to an audience of extension veterinarians and animal health regulators. There will be 5 minutes allowed for Q&A.

Even though there is no funding available for presenters, don't let that stop you from sending in an abstract to the moderators! Please submit them by July 15, 2011. You are not required to register for USAHA if you are only attending/presenting at this session. If you want to attend USAHA, we welcome it as it is a great meeting.
